Eleven years later there was a 10 minute sketch of Only Fools And Horses called Beckham In Peckham that was produced for the 2014 Sports Relief event- this would be the last we see of the Trotters so far & likely (unfortunately) ever again. Writer John Sullivan had sadly already passed away by this time but the script was written by his son Jim Sullivan by utilising unfinished lines/scripts that his late father had left behind from his time working on the show. Well worth a watch- its available to watch officially on KZfaq.
